Dialpad's Agent Session Metrics report provides insight into how each agent—and your AI Agent—handles digital customer sessions, grouped at the agent level.
It surfaces key measures such as total digital session volume over time, average first response time, and average handle time to highlight speed and efficiency, plus AI-focused metrics, helping you evaluate performance, coaching opportunities, and the impact of AI assistance across your digital support team.

Default Filters
This report contains two default filters:
Digital Sessions Created Time (Required)
Digital Sessions Chat Type
Visualization Type
The Agent Session Metrics report is a templated report displayed in a table format.
Select Settings (the gear icon) > Download to save your data to your computer, with multiple formatting and selection options.
Data Dictionary
This report contains unique Analytics definitions — read through the following table to learn more about the data in your report.
Agent Identity |
Includes User ID, Email, Name, and Phone for precise tracking. |
Sessions Count |
The total volume of digital sessions handled per agent over the last 30 days. |
Avg. First Response Time (AFRT) |
Measures how quickly your team acknowledges a new digital request. |
Avg. Handle Time (AHT) |
Total time spent per session (Used to identify coaching opportunities). |
